At Each, we believe health and wellbeing belong to everyone and for some, healing begins in nature. We're seeking an Adventure Therapy Outdoor Leader to join our WILD program - a nature-based, evidence-informed initiative helping people discover their strengths through immersive bush experiences.

WILD offers tailored programs for schools, workplaces and community groups, guiding participants through challenges that build resilience, confidence and connection. From single-day adventures to multi-day expeditions, our facilitators use movement, reflection and outdoor activities to boost mental wellbeing and unlock personal growth.

Your next adventure could include :

Abseiling, rock climbing, bushwalking, orienteering

White water rafting, canoeing, stand-up paddleboarding, river sledding

Snorkelling, team initiative games, camp cooking, overnight expeditions

Your role, your impact

As part of our collaborative WILD team, you'll :

Lead the design and delivery of adventure activity programs — from single-day sessions to 5-day camps

Co-create tailored outdoor learning experiences with clients, schools, and community partners

Facilitate reflective group discussions and nature-based therapeutic activities

Prepare and manage logistics including safety checks, gear, transport, catering, and post-program follow-up

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ders and participants

Collect and use program data for evaluation and continuous improvement

Support participants and families for up to 6 months post-program

Help grow our social enterprise through new partnerships and fee-for-service opportunities

Who we're looking for

You're an outdoor activity leader who thrives on challenge, adventure and purpose. You're calm under pressure, collaborative by nature, and skilled at creating inclusive, supportive learning environments for young people and diverse communities.

You will also have :

Minimum certificate IV in Outdoor Recreation or equivalent

Remote or Wilderness First Aid (current)

CPR (current)

Current Driver's License

Certificates or equivalent logged experience in at least three outdoor activities (e.g. bushwalking, abseiling, canoeing, surfing, etc.)

Minimum 2 years experience leading groups in outdoor and remote environments.

Swiftwater Rescue Technician qualification (or willingness to obtain)

What will make you standout?

Mental health or social work qualification

Rigid bus license

Bronze Medallion or Community Rescue Award

Experience supporting at-risk youth and vulnerable populations within community or healthcare settings.
